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– राज्ञः परमाददॊषेण दस्युभिः परिमुष्यताम

Shloka (श्लोक)

राज्ञः परमाददॊषेण दस्युभिः परिमुष्यताम
अशरण्यः परजानां यः स राजा कलिर उच्यते

⚡ Quick Meaning

The ruler, through negligence, loses the support of the helpless, thus becoming infamous.

Translations

English Translation

This verse describes how a careless king, who fails to protect his subjects, particularly the vulnerable, earns a reputation for tyranny and neglect, reducing his legacy.

हिंदी अनुवाद

यह श्लोक बताता है कि जो राजा अपने प्रजा की रक्षा में असफल रहता है, विशेषकर असहाय जनों की, वह नकारात्मक पहचान बनाता है और दुष्ट कहलाता है।

Commentary

Context

This verse highlights the responsibility of rulers as leaders in safeguarding the welfare of their subjects.

Meaning

It conveys the message that neglecting duty leads to negative consequences, both for the ruler and the ruled.

Application

This teaches us the importance of responsibility and care in leadership roles, emphasizing service before self.
